The ESAB Confort 600 Amps Electrode Holder is built for heavy-duty welding performance, offering maximum safety, comfort, and reliability in demanding industrial environments. Rated for up to 600 Amps, this electrode holder is ideal for manual metal arc (MMA) welding and is compatible with electrodes up to 6.3 mm in diameter.
Designed with fiberglass reinforced plastic and a fully insulated head, it ensures electrical safety, heat resistance, and operator comfort. Whether you’re in fabrication, shipbuilding, or structural repair, the Confort 600 provides a solid grip and dependable performance, making it a must-have tool for professionals and serious welders alike.
